2026 Best Value Software Engineering Schools in the United States

Below are the schools that deliver the strongest value in software engineering, balancing cost against outcomes.

Best Value Software Engineering Schools

1

California State University Fullerton tops our 2026 list of the best value software engineering schools in the United States. California State University Fullerton is a very large public school located in the suburb of Fullerton. In-state tuition and fees average $7,470, with out-of-state students paying around $20,070. Software Engineering graduates carry a median of $18,500 in student loans. Early-career software engineering graduates make about $113,000. That is a strong return on a $18,500 median debt. The acceptance rate is 90%.

Notes and References

This ranking is produced by College Factual (MF_RANKING_2025), 2026 edition. Schools are scored on the balance of cost (tuition and student debt) against student outcomes (post-graduation earnings) — a measure of return on investment, drawn primarily from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S and College Scorecard).

Ranking method: College Major Best Value · 175 schools evaluated.

*Averages shown above reflect the top 27 ranked schools only.
